Основы HTML и CSS для стартующих
Построение сайтов стартует с постижения двух важнейших технологий. HTML отвечает за организацию и содержимое страниц. CSS управляет внешним стилизацией компонентов.
Веб-мастера задействуют HTML для вставки текста, изображений, линков и других компонентов. CSS позволяет устанавливать цвета, гарнитуры, размеры и размещение контейнеров. Эти языки функционируют совместно и дополняются друг друга.
Овладение вулкан официальный сайт даёт путь к специальности веб-разработчика. Владение базовых правил способствует создавать работающие и красивые сайты. Стартующие разработчики могут быстро получить прикладные навыки и использовать их в реальных задачах.
Что такое HTML и зачем он нужен сайту
HTML расшифровывается как HyperText Markup Language. Язык разметки определяет организацию веб-документов и организует содержимое веб-страниц. Браузеры обрабатывают HTML-код и представляют сведения в ясном для посетителей формате.
Каждый блок веб-страницы описывается специальными директивами. Названия, параграфы, списки, таблицы и формы создаются с посредством тегов. Метки представляют собой команды, помещённые в угловые скобки. Браузер читает эти команды и формирует зрительное представление контента.
Без HTML нельзя создать Вулкан казино любого рода. Язык разметки выступает фундаментом для всех веб-ресурсов. Поисковые сервисы обрабатывают HTML-структуру для индексации страниц. Верная структура улучшает позиции сайта в выдаче запроса.
HTML постоянно совершенствуется и обретает новые опции. Новейшая версия HTML5 обеспечивает видео, аудио и динамические компоненты. Специалисты могут встраивать мультимедийный контент без дополнительных модулей. Смысловые теги позволяют Вулкан лучше осознавать функцию разных элементов страницы.
Основные метки и архитектура веб-страницы
Любой HTML-документ содержит строгую многоуровневую организацию. Корневой компонент html вмещает всё контент веб-страницы. Внутри располагаются два основных секции: head и body.
Блок head сохраняет служебную сведения о файле. Здесь определяется титул веб-страницы, присоединяются стили и скрипты. Пользователи не воспринимают контент этого блока прямо. Секция body вмещает весь отображаемый материал.
Для структурирования контента задействуются разные метки:
- h1-h6 генерируют заголовки разнообразных степеней
- p оформляет текстовые абзацы
- a генерирует гиперссылки на иные веб-страницы
- img встраивает изображения в страницу
- ul и ol генерируют маркированные и нумерованные списки
- table упорядочивает данные в табличном формате
Смысловые метки делают структуру более ясной. Компонент header определяет шапку портала. Элемент nav объединяет навигационные линки. Раздел main содержит главное наполнение веб-страницы. Footer размещается в нижней области и содержит контактную информацию.
Верная архитектура документа существенна для доступности. Программы чтения с экрана применяют казино Вулкан для навигации по веб-странице. Последовательная структура элементов упрощает восприятие контента всеми группами зрителей. Соответствующий программа функционирует корректно во всех современных обозревателях.
Как CSS отвечает за внешний облик сайта
CSS расшифровывается как Cascading Style Sheets. Каскадные таблицы стилей определяют визуальное представление HTML-элементов. Инструмент разделяет стилизацию от структуры документа.
Без стилей все сайты отображаются однообразно. Браузер показывает текст чёрным цветом на белом подложке. Названия приобретают стандартные величины. CSS даёт возможность модифицировать каждый элемент внешнего вида.
Стили можно присоединить тремя способами. Внешний документ связывается с HTML-документом посредством элемент link. Внутренние стили размещаются в метке style. Inline стили записываются в свойстве компонента.
Каскадность обозначает приоритет применения директив. Inline стили получают высший преимущество. Внутренние стили переопределяют внешние. Браузер использует наиболее конкретное директиву к каждому компоненту.
CSS регулирует всеми зрительными параметрами. Разработчики настраивают тона фона и текста. Стили модифицируют величины, интервалы и границы блоков. Современный Вулкан казино задействует анимации и переходы для генерации динамических визуальных эффектов.
Селекторы, атрибуты и значения в CSS
Правило CSS формируется из трёх частей. Селектор определяет элемент для оформления. Параметр задаёт параметр оформления. Значение устанавливает конкретный параметр.
Селекторы выбирают элементы по различным критериям. Селектор тега использует стили ко всем элементам конкретного типа. Селектор класса функционирует с свойством class. Селектор идентификатора выбирает индивидуальный элемент по атрибуту id.
Комбинированные селекторы формируют более конкретные инструкции. Селектор потомка выбирает вставленные элементы. Селектор непосредственного элемента действует только с непосредственными детьми. Псевдоклассы назначают стили при заданных состояниях.
Атрибуты определяют различные стороны оформления. Параметры color и background-color контролируют цветовой схемой. Свойства width и height определяют габариты. Параметры margin и padding регулируют интервалы.
Величины записываются в различных видах. Тона задаются в шестнадцатеричном формате, RGB или наименованиями. Размеры измеряются в пикселях, процентах или пропорциональных величинах. Грамотное использование селекторов позволяет Вулкан эффективно управлять оформлением большого количества элементов.
Управление с цветами, шрифтами и отступами
Цветовое оформление формирует визуальную атмосферу веб-страницы. Атрибут color изменяет оттенок текста. Свойство background-color определяет подложку компонента. Оттенки прописываются несколькими способами: наименованиями, шестнадцатеричными обозначениями или параметрами RGB.
Шестнадцатеричный вид начинается с знака решётки. Запись состоит из шести символов, определяющих красный, зелёный и синий компоненты. Тип RGB применяет числовые значения от 0 до 255 для каждого компонента. Формат RGBA добавляет свойство альфа-канала.
Оформление текста сказывается на восприятие контента. Параметр font-family определяет семейство шрифта. Атрибут font-size устанавливает величину текста. Свойство font-weight управляет жирность начертания. Параметр line-height определяет межстрочный промежуток.
Встроенные гарнитуры доступны на всех аппаратах. Веб-шрифты подгружаются с удалённых серверов. Платформа Google Fonts предоставляет безвозмездную коллекцию гарнитур. Разработчики перечисляют несколько гарнитур в очерёдности предпочтения.
Поля формируют пространство около компонентов. Атрибут margin формирует наружные интервалы между блоками. Свойство padding генерирует внутренние поля от границ до контента. Поля можно устанавливать для каждой стороны отдельно или одним параметром одновременно для всех сторон. Правильное применение казино Вулкан улучшает зрительную структуру и восприятие информации.
Блочная концепция и размещение блоков
Блочная модель характеризует структуру каждого HTML-элемента. Концепция формируется из четырёх областей: содержимого, внутреннего интервала, обводки и внешнего отступа. Осознание этой концепции необходимо для точного регулирования габаритами.
Область содержимого содержит текст и иллюстрации. Внутренний интервал padding формирует пространство между содержимым и границей. Рамка border обрамляет компонент заметной чертой. Внешний интервал margin генерирует расстояние до соседних контейнеров.
Параметр box-sizing изменяет расчёт величин. Параметр content-box считает только содержимое. Вариант border-box вмещает padding и border в суммарную размер.
Параметр display определяет режим визуализации. Блочные элементы захватывают всю доступную ширину. Строчные элементы размещаются в одной строке. Вариант inline-block сочетает свойства обоих типов.
Свойство position регулирует позиционированием. Вариант relative смещает блок относительно исходного положения. Absolute позиционирует элемент относительно родительского контейнера. Новейший Вулкан казино задействует Flexbox и Grid для формирования многоуровневых структур.
Адаптивная верстка для разнообразных аппаратов
Отзывчивая верстка предоставляет правильное отображение сайта на всех мониторах. Пользователи посещают на страницы с ПК, планшетных устройств и мобильных устройств. Макет обязан адаптироваться под размер экрана самостоятельно.
Медиазапросы применяют стили в зависимости от свойств платформы. Инструкция @media проверяет ширину экрана и иные свойства. Программисты генерируют индивидуальные комплекты стилей для разнообразных диапазонов габаритов.
Принцип mobile-first открывает создание с версии для смартфонов. Начальные стили описывают стилизацию для небольших дисплеев. Медиазапросы включают расширения для широких дисплеев.
Гибкие структуры задействуют относительные единицы измерения. Ширина блоков устанавливается в процентах вместо постоянных точек. Flexbox и Grid генерируют отзывчивые структуры без сложных подсчётов.
Картинки нуждаются повышенного внимания при оптимизации. Параметр max-width со значением 100% исключает выход картинок за пределы элемента. Атрибут srcset подгружает изображения разнообразного разрешения. Грамотная внедрение казино Вулкан усиливает пользовательский восприятие на всех категориях платформ.
Распространённые недочёты стартующих при разработке с HTML и CSS
Новички разработчики допускают стандартные ошибки при разработке веб-страниц. Понимание частых проблем позволяет избежать их в своих работах. Коррекция промахов на ранних этапах сберегает время и усиливает качество программы.
Основные недочёты при разработке с структурой и стилями:
- Незакрытые метки нарушают структуру страницы и приводят к некорректному отображению
- Применение устаревших элементов вместо новых смысловых элементов
- Недостаток замещающего текста для картинок снижает доступность контента
- Inline стили в HTML затрудняют сопровождение и корректировку оформления
- Неправильная вложенность элементов создаёт конфликты в организации
- Излишнее задействование идентификаторов вместо классов ограничивает многократное применение стилей
Ошибки с CSS также возникают часто. Новички забывают задавать меры измерения для числовых значений. Излишне точные селекторы затрудняют корректировку стилей. Отсутствие обнуления стилей браузера создаёт отличия в визуализации на разных устройствах.
Игнорирование кроссбраузерной совместимости ведёт к ошибкам. Сайт может отлично смотреться в одном обозревателе и ошибочно в ином. Проверка программы через особые сервисы находит синтаксические ошибки. Регулярная верификация позволяет Вулкан поддерживать превосходное качество разработки и согласованность стандартам.